Japanese versions:
Longview features a picture of Bumblebee.
Spy Shot features a picture of Optimus Prime.
Speed Dial features a picture of the Autobot symbol with a blue background.
The Japanese versions also come with a Japanese flyer showing the first wave Movie products that are available. On the opposite side the flyer features a Transformers Chronicle along with pictures of the Sports Label and Music Label Transformers.
